Output ecfa1b3e64f6725833764f2fe44e42a70e59837edf1cef44923802c041a9a64c:1

value
38959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b750270e15688692a0fd7a807bc41dce239b49 OP_EQUAL
address
34wsB5Jc385A9RHK67GTGRehdVKECUGsbm
transaction
ecfa1b3e64f6725833764f2fe44e42a70e59837edf1cef44923802c041a9a64c
spent
true